WebIn the Access Options box, click Client Settings. In the Advanced section, under Default open mode, select Shared, click OK, and then exit Access. Copy the database file to the shared folder. After you copy the file, make sure that the file attributes are set to allow read/write access to the database file. WebIn MS Access, SQL can be found in queries (view a query in SQL View). It can also be used in VBA to construct custom queries to manipulate data (this will be covered later in the post). Note: In MS Access, every communication with the database uses SQL to some degree although this is not always obvious. WebYou can use Access to automatically convert macros to VBA modules or class modules. You can convert macros that are attached to a form or report, whether they exist as separate objects or as embedded macros. You can also convert global macros that are not attached to a specific form or report. WebTo add criteria to an Access query, open the query in Design view and identify the fields (columns) you want to specify criteria for. If the field is not in the design grid, double-click the field to add it to the design grid and then enter the criterion in the Criteria row for that field.
